Mobile outbound gross enrolment ratio, tertiary students studying in in Cape Verde
Cape Verde: Mobile outbound gross enrolment ratio, tertiary students studying in was 15.4% in 2023. ▲ Rising
Mobile outbound gross enrolment ratio, tertiary students studying in in Cape Verde, 1998–2023
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in %.
Analysis
Cape Verde recorded 15.4% for mobile outbound gross enrolment ratio, tertiary students studying in in 2023. That is the highest value across all 26 years on record.
The figure is up 18.6% on the previous year and up 175.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, mobile outbound gross enrolment ratio, tertiary students studying in in Cape Verde peaked at 15.4% in 2023 and was at its lowest, 3.7%, in 2009.
Cape Verde ranks 11th of 209 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 26 years of available data.
